Default Mar Vista Tower

Actually it was a utility pole with four long panels hanging down. Saw a guy installing grey, notebook sized , Nokia modules in a cabinet . I asked him who owned the the site, guy said "41 41" I said AT&T? He said "yeah". I thought Mar Vista was all NIMBYed out. Very surprised about the installation, Mar Vista is a notorious dead spot. Saw a post awhile ago about possible AT&T towers in Mar Vista, but I thought they were turned down by city of Los Angeles planning.

Default Mar Vista Tower

That is a tough area. I believe Utility pole installations are exempt from public hearing in certain cases. Sometimes the carrier's can find a place to install a microcell that does not require a public hearing by the City of LA planning. That is probably what happened here. Sprint had a few sites denied by the LA city zoning board last year in Hollywood Hills and then decided to find places that do not require a public hearing to avoid the NIMBY's. Those NIMBY"s still came out to protest when they saw the construction but found out they had no say in it this time. [img]i/expressions/face-icon-small-smile.gif[/img]
